Proximity fuze is a gameplay feature introduced in Ace Combat 6: Fires of Liberation.
In most Ace Combat games, a missile will not cause any damage to enemy units unless it lands a direct hit. In Ace Combat 6, missiles that perform a very near miss will detonate and inflict reduced damage to an enemy as a result of a proximity fuze.[1][2]
Ace Combat 6 remains the only Ace Combat game to have proximity fuze on standard missiles. In later games, the feature became the Short-Range Aerial Suppression Air-to-Air Missile special weapon.
